LINUX.ORG.RU

Transmission не может присоедениться к трекеру

 , , ,


0

1

Всем привет,

Поставил Transmission 2.82, настроил. Все работает кроме скачивания. Сам торрент в список добавляется, но дальше дело не идет. В логах пишется «Could not connect to tracker».

Если важно:
- Gentoo
- Запускаю так: /etc/init.d/transmission-daemon start
- Использую WEB клиент
- Сеть проводная (без wifi)
- Рутер/NAT
- Параллельно стоит deluge - работает
- rutracker

Как анализировать? Что может быть?

Лог запуска, при котором добавлен один торрент:

[14:51:47.795] Transmission 2.82 (14160) started (session.c:738)
[14:51:47.795] RPC Server Adding address to whitelist: 127.0.0.1 (rpc-server.c:828)
[14:51:47.795] RPC Server Serving RPC and Web requests on port 127.0.0.1:9091/transmission/ (rpc-server.c:1035)
[14:51:47.795] RPC Server Whitelist enabled (rpc-server.c:1039)
[14:51:47.795] DHT Generating new id (tr-dht.c:310)
[14:51:47.795] Using settings from "/mnt/data/_p2p/.config/transmission" (daemon.c:526)
[14:51:47.795] Saved "/mnt/data/_p2p/.config/transmission/settings.json" (variant.c:1217)
[14:51:47.795] Saved pidfile "/var/run/transmission/transmission.pid" (daemon.c:538)
[14:51:47.795] Watching "/mnt/data/_p2p/transmission/torrents" for new .torrent files (daemon.c:564)
[14:51:47.795] Using inotify to watch directory "/mnt/data/_p2p/transmission/torrents" (watch.c:74)
[14:51:47.795] Loaded 1 torrents (session.c:1994)
[14:51:47.795] Port Forwarding (NAT-PMP) initnatpmp succeeded (0) (natpmp.c:73)
[14:51:47.795] Port Forwarding (NAT-PMP) sendpublicaddressrequest succeeded (2) (natpmp.c:73)
[14:51:49.796] Port Forwarding (UPnP) Found Internet Gateway Device "http://192.168.0.1:65535/ctl/IPConn" (upnp.c:202)
[14:51:49.796] Port Forwarding (UPnP) Local Address is "192.168.0.100" (upnp.c:204)
[14:51:49.796] Port Forwarding (UPnP) Port forwarding through "http://192.168.0.1:65535/ctl/IPConn", service "urn:schemas-upnp-org:service:WANIPConnection:1". (local address: 192.168.0.100:51413) (upnp.c:279)
[14:51:49.796] Port Forwarding (UPnP) Port forwarding successful! (upnp.c:282)
[14:51:49.796] Port Forwarding State changed from "Not forwarded" to "Forwarded" (port-forwarding.c:95)
[14:51:49.796] <Torrent Name Here> Could not connect to tracker (announcer.c:999)
[14:51:49.796] <Torrent Name Here> Retrying announce in 20 seconds. (announcer.c:1008)
[14:52:03.803] <Torrent Name Here> Starting IPv4 DHT announce (poor, 11 nodes) (tr-dht.c:576)
[14:52:09.806] DHT Attempting bootstrap from dht.transmissionbt.com (tr-dht.c:248)
...

★★★★★

Ответ на: комментарий от Pinkbyte
$ cat ~p2p/.config/transmission/settings.json 
{
    "alt-speed-down": 50, 
    "alt-speed-enabled": false, 
    "alt-speed-time-begin": 540, 
    "alt-speed-time-day": 127, 
    "alt-speed-time-enabled": false, 
    "alt-speed-time-end": 1020, 
    "alt-speed-up": 50, 
    "bind-address-ipv4": "0.0.0.0", 
    "bind-address-ipv6": "::", 
    "blocklist-enabled": false, 
    "blocklist-url": "http://www.example.com/blocklist", 
    "cache-size-mb": 4, 
    "dht-enabled": true, 
    "download-dir": "/mnt/data/_p2p/transmission/downloads", 
    "download-queue-enabled": true, 
    "download-queue-size": 5, 
    "encryption": 1, 
    "idle-seeding-limit": 30, 
    "idle-seeding-limit-enabled": false, 
    "incomplete-dir": "/mnt/data/_p2p/transmission/incomplete", 
    "incomplete-dir-enabled": true, 
    "lpd-enabled": false, 
    "message-level": 2, 
    "peer-congestion-algorithm": "", 
    "peer-id-ttl-hours": 6, 
    "peer-limit-global": 200, 
    "peer-limit-per-torrent": 50, 
    "peer-port": 51413, 
    "peer-port-random-high": 65535, 
    "peer-port-random-low": 49152, 
    "peer-port-random-on-start": false, 
    "peer-socket-tos": "default", 
    "pex-enabled": true, 
    "pidfile": "/var/run/transmission/transmission.pid", 
    "port-forwarding-enabled": true, 
    "preallocation": 2, 
    "prefetch-enabled": 1, 
    "queue-stalled-enabled": true, 
    "queue-stalled-minutes": 30, 
    "ratio-limit": 2, 
    "ratio-limit-enabled": false, 
    "rename-partial-files": true, 
    "rpc-authentication-required": false, 
    "rpc-bind-address": "0.0.0.0", 
    "rpc-enabled": true, 
    "rpc-password": "*****************************",
    "rpc-port": 9091, 
    "rpc-url": "/transmission/", 
    "rpc-username": "", 
    "rpc-whitelist": "127.0.0.1", 
    "rpc-whitelist-enabled": true, 
    "scrape-paused-torrents-enabled": true, 
    "script-torrent-done-enabled": false, 
    "script-torrent-done-filename": "", 
    "seed-queue-enabled": false, 
    "seed-queue-size": 10, 
    "speed-limit-down": 100, 
    "speed-limit-down-enabled": false, 
    "speed-limit-up": 100, 
    "speed-limit-up-enabled": false, 
    "start-added-torrents": true, 
    "trash-original-torrent-files": false, 
    "umask": 18, 
    "upload-slots-per-torrent": 14, 
    "utp-enabled": true, 
    "watch-dir": "/mnt/data/_p2p/transmission/torrents", 
    "watch-dir-enabled": true
}

Kroz ★★★★★
() автор топика

дай сам торент файл или магнет ссылку.

[14:51:49.796] <Torrent Name Here> Could not connect to tracker (announcer.c:999)

Нет соединения с трекером.

Dron ★★★★★
()

Посмотри от какого пользователя запускается transmission, и есть ли у него права на запись в директории куда качаешь и где конфиги.

haku ★★★★★
()
Ответ на: комментарий от Pinkbyte

O_O

Скачался. Попробовал на более большом файле - поначалу есть задержка (по сравнению с deluge), но потом скачивается. В логах сабжевые сообщения сыпятся.

В общем, снимаю критичность с проблемы, но если есть идеи - буду рад.

Kroz ★★★★★
() автор топика

Самое банальное что может быть это бан клиента. Еще кстати, проверь пожалуйста как у тебя deluge раздает по сравнению с transmission, а то последний на моей памяти с этим сильно лажал. Сейчас пользуюсь им и проблем как таковых нет, но иногда накатывают смутные сомнения, когда вижу соотношение сидов/пиров и свою реальную скорость отдачи. С deluge работал давно и опыт чисто качества раздач очень положительный.

Lordwind ★★★★★
()
Ответ на: комментарий от haku

Посмотри от какого пользователя запускается transmission, и есть ли у него права на запись в директории куда качаешь и где конфиги.

$ ls -la ~p2p/transmission
total 0
drwxr-xr-x  5 root root  136 мар 22 14:25 .
drwxr-xr-x 11 p2p  users 336 мар 22 14:25 ..
drwxr-xr-x  3 p2p  users 152 мар 22 15:37 downloads
drwxr-xr-x  2 p2p  users 120 мар 22 15:41 incomplete
drwxr-xr-x  2 p2p  users 160 мар 22 15:41 torrents

$ cat ~p2p/.config/transmission/settings.json | grep p2p
    "download-dir": "/mnt/data/_p2p/transmission/downloads", 
    "incomplete-dir": "/mnt/data/_p2p/transmission/incomplete", 
    "watch-dir": "/mnt/data/_p2p/transmission/torrents",

$ ps -eo euser,ruser,suser,fuser,f,comm | grep transmission
p2p      p2p      p2p      p2p      1 transmission-da

См. еще мой ответ выше: Transmission не может присоедениться к трекеру (комментарий)

Kroz ★★★★★
() автор топика
Ответ на: комментарий от Black_Roland

SELinux никакого нету?

Нет:

$ eselect profile list
Available profile symlink targets:
  [1]   default/linux/x86/13.0
  [2]   default/linux/x86/13.0/selinux
  [3]   default/linux/x86/13.0/desktop
  [4]   default/linux/x86/13.0/desktop/gnome
  [5]   default/linux/x86/13.0/desktop/gnome/systemd
  [6]   default/linux/x86/13.0/desktop/kde *          <<<<<<<
  [7]   default/linux/x86/13.0/desktop/kde/systemd
  [8]   default/linux/x86/13.0/developer
  [9]   hardened/linux/x86
  [10]  hardened/linux/x86/selinux
  [11]  hardened/linux/uclibc/x86
См. еще мой ответ выше: Transmission не может присоедениться к трекеру (комментарий)

Kroz ★★★★★
() автор топика

Ну в генте пользователя «P2P» ты сам создавал и конфиги в непонятное место ты тоже сам клал. Это комментарий от К.О.

Waldo-de-Kard ★★
()
Ответ на: комментарий от Lordwind

кстати на рутрекере deluge забанен

Да, отчасти из-за этого перехожу на transmission А вот transmission - норм.

http://rutracker.org/forum/viewtopic.php?t=2965837

Для Ъ:


Версии клиентов, несовместимые с данным трекером:

µTorrent: 1.7.0, 2.0.4(билд 21515)
BitComet: 0.63, 0.9.1, 0.9.4-1.0.2
BitLord: 1.1
BitTornado: версии до 0.3.17 включительно
CTorrent: версии, выпущенные до 3.0
Deluge: все (забанен до официально подтвержденного исправления утечки пасскеев)
FlashGet: все
MediaGet: билд 2.01.682
Opera: все
qBittorrent: билды 2.6.7-2.8.*
SymTorrent: все

Версии клиентов, не рекомендуемые для использования на данном трекере:

Azureus / Vuze: все версии
µTorrent: 1.8.3-1.8.5; 3.0 и выше (крайне не рекомендуется 3.3) (Прежде чем задавать вопросы - прочтите мини-фак)
BitTorrent: 6.2 и выше
BitComet: версии, выпущенные до 0.61
Transmission: версии, выпущенные до 1.92 включительно

MediaGet / MediaGet2 — внимание! Данный клиент является вредоносным программным обеспечением!
[./code]

Kroz ★★★★★
() автор топика
Ответ на: комментарий от Waldo-de-Kard

Ну в генте пользователя «P2P» ты сам создавал и конфиги в непонятное место ты тоже сам клал. Это комментарий от К.О.

К. О. Как раз говорит, что ошибка совершенно к этому не относится. Пользователь может не иметь доступу к ресурсу, учитывая отсутствие SELinux - к файлам/каталогам. У меня конфиги читаются, в директории доступ есть. Проблем в сети - связь с трекером.

Kroz ★★★★★
() автор топика
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.